What is the salary of a Special Education Office? In the United States, a Special Education Office earns an average salary of $96,958. The salary range for a Special Education Office is usually between $55,579 and $119,712 per year, representing the 25th to 75th percentiles respectively. The top 10% of earners, that is the 90th percentile, have an annual salary of $129,812. The highest Special Education Office salary in the United States was $155,544. The average hourly pay for a Special Education Office is $46.61.
